At least 28 killed in Central African Republic violence

At least 28 people were killed and dozens were injured in clashes between armed groups in the Central African Republic, police said on Thursday.

"Violent clashes broke out on Tuesday in the centre of Mbres," an official from the armed police told AFP, adding that the death toll had been given by the local Red Cross.
